The benefits of neutering golden retrievers a. Benefits to male golden retrievers 1. less likely to get testicular cancer. This is a relatively common condition in older uncastrated golden retrievers. 2. avoid benign prostate hypertrophy. The disease can lead to difficulty in urinating and defecating in Golden Retrievers because male hormones can affect the enlarged prostate. 3. reduce the incidence of anal gland swelling. The anal gland swelling, which is a tumor around the anus, generally leads to inflammation, bleeding and sometimes difficulty in defecation in male golden retrievers. Second, the benefits to the female Golden 1. by doing spaying, the female Golden’s semi-annual or annual heat period will disappear. 2. the risk of breast cancer is greatly reduced. If the Golden female has her ovaries removed before she goes into heat for the first time, the possibility of getting the disease is basically negligible. 3. The chance of getting diabetes can be reduced. Early spaying can reduce the likelihood of diabetes in female Goldens because the disease is associated with changes in the level of hormones produced by the ovaries. 4. You won’t get uterine abscesses. The female will have less chance of getting lost or injured, and will have more time to stay home and play with her owner.
